Monitoring Network Cables: A Comprehensive Guide261


Network cables are a critical part of any network, but they can also be a source of problems. By monitoring network cables, you can identify and resolve issues before they cause major disruptions.

There are several different tools and techniques that can be used to monitor network cables. One common method is to use a cable tester. A cable tester can be used to check the continuity of a cable, as well as its length and other characteristics. Another method is to use a network monitoring system. A network monitoring system can be used to monitor the performance of a network, including the status of the network cables.

When monitoring network cables, there are several key things to look for. These include:
Breaks: Breaks can occur in cables due to physical damage, such as from being stepped on or cut. Breaks can cause the network to lose connectivity.
Shorts: Shorts can occur when two wires in a cable touch each other. Shorts can cause the network to lose connectivity or to experience errors.
Attenuation: Attenuation is a loss of signal strength over a distance. Attenuation can cause the network to slow down or to lose connectivity.
Crosstalk: Crosstalk occurs when signals from one cable interfere with signals from another cable. Crosstalk can cause the network to experience errors.

If you suspect that there is a problem with a network cable, the first step is to visually inspect the cable for any damage. If there is no visible damage, you can use a cable tester or a network monitoring system to test the cable.

Once you have identified the problem, you can take steps to resolve it. If the cable is broken, you will need to replace it. If there is a short, you will need to find the location of the short and repair it. If there is attenuation, you may need to use a different type of cable or to install a network amplifier.

By monitoring network cables, you can help to prevent network problems and ensure that your network is running at peak performance.
